> You can use one DHCP-Server for all subnets if using dhcrelay. If using > Cisco equipment look into ip-helper command.
Or you can multi-home (have it listen on multiple subnets) the DHCP sever. I prefer to keep routers doing the job they are intended to do, route. But that's just me.
